Discocheilus is a genus of freshwater ray-finned fish belonging to the family Cyprinidae, the carps, barbs, minnows and related fishes. The species which belong to this genus are endemic to China.{{Cof genus|genus=Discocheilus|access-date=19 December 2024}}
Species
Discocheiluscontains the following species:
- Discocheilus multilepis (D. Z. Wang & D. J. Li, 1994)
- Discocheilus wui (J. X. Chen & J. H. Lan, 1992)
- Discocheilus wuluoheensis (W. X. Li, Z. M. Lu & W. L. Mao, 1996)
